Description
Focus on Stability and Flint Kernel Structure
When it comes to commercial grain production in temperate climates, agronomists are increasingly choosing hybrids with a flint kernel type. "Locus" from NPFG "Kompaniya Mais" is a solution for those who prioritize reliability and crop predictability. With an FAO range of 90–1240, this simple hybrid demonstrates high adaptability to various soil and climatic zones of Ukraine.
Biological Armor
The main advantage of Locus is its genetic resistance to the most dangerous pathogens. While many intensive hybrids require constant fungicidal pressure, Locus shows a high resistance threshold to:
- Loose smut;
- Common smut;
- European corn borer infestation.
These are not just technical specifications, but a tangible reduction in pesticide costs throughout the season. Resistance to smut diseases makes it attractive for farms with monoculture crop rotations, where the infection background is traditionally higher.
Agronomic Profile
Maturation within 100–110 days allows for scheduling harvest at optimal times, avoiding excessive moisture accumulation in the grain. As a simple hybrid, Locus offers excellent uniformity, which is crucial for even ripening and avoiding field heterogeneity before combining.
Who should consider this hybrid? First and foremost, farmers focused on stable grain production. If your strategy involves risk minimization and achieving predictable results without the need to invest in overly expensive intensive protection programs, Locus will become a reliable asset in your agricultural toolkit.
